1. The service

Avecta turns SVG artwork into build-up animation videos: your image is redrawn shape by shape and rendered into an MP4. Reanimation takes SVG files. To animate a photo, the separate Vectorize tool first traces a PNG or JPEG into an SVG you can download and then reanimate. Every frame is produced by a conventional rendering algorithm; the video is not generated by AI (see our Privacy Policy for the one optional model we use and what it does).
